The Fake Gambling Games Finally Grabbed Me

What begins as a harmless, colorful distraction can quietly evolve into an unexpected time sink. This is the reality for a growing number of casual gamers who find themselves captivated by apps and online games that cleverly mimic the mechanics of gambling, all without any real money changing hands.

The experience is often disarmingly simple. A user might describe the compulsion to help animated raccoons slide coins for hours on end, chasing the satisfying clinks, flashing lights, and the promise of a big, virtual jackpot. These games are meticulously designed to trigger the same psychological rewards as slot machines or other games of chance. They employ variable ratio reinforcement—where the reward is unpredictable—keeping players engaged in a loop of anticipation with just enough small wins to prevent them from quitting.

While no financial loss occurs, the cost is measured in time. Hours can disappear into these brightly lit digital casinos, often filled with aggressive prompts to watch ads for bonuses or to make in-app purchases for power-ups. The line between playful entertainment and compulsive behavior becomes blurred, raising questions about the ethical design of such experiences, especially as they become accessible to younger audiences. The experience serves as a cautionary tale about how easily engaging mechanics can lead to unintended, prolonged engagement, leaving players to wonder where the afternoon went.
